Barclay's Willow (Salix Barclayi) is a perennial shrub in the Salicaceae family with moderate care difficulty. It requires high watering and full sun or partial shade light in USDA hardiness zones 2-7. This plant is safe for cats and dogs.

Salix barclayi, commonly known as Barclay's willow, is a shrub or small tree native to North America, particularly found in tundra and upper parts of the USA.
